Announced Today: The Connection Cloud Launches Breakthrough Technology, Giving Business Users Real-Time Access to SaaS Data in the Cloud
June 19, 2012
The Connection Cloud, a revolutionary technology enabling real-time access to SaaS data in the cloud, launched today, solving a major data integration headache for business end users and IT managers. For the first time, using the Connection Cloud, users can get at the underlying SaaS data where it resides, skipping the many complex integration steps they previously had to take.
“The Connection Cloud is a game changer for us. In the past integrating operational data from SaaS applications for reporting and analysis for our clients has been challenging.Every SaaS application has a different way to access data.” said Mike Vannoy, COO of Austin, TX sales acceleration company Sales Engine International. “Now I tell the Connection Cloud which SaaS data I need and suddenly I have access to it, in real-time, from where it sits.”
The Connection Cloud allows easy access and retrieval of real-time data from multiple SaaS applications, which significantly reduces the cost of deployment and management of data integration solutions.
“The simpler we can make access to data for business users, the sooner they can start to use our solutions to support important business decisions.” said Joseph Rozenfeld, Chief Technology Officer of Jaspersoft. “Partnering with the Connection Cloud gives our customers easy access to SaaS data for operational reporting and analysis. This is an enormous leap forward in realizing the power of cloud-based computing,” he added.
